Knowing the Core Principles of Hydraulic Technology

At the center of hydraulic Technology is Pascal's Law, which states that tension applied to a confined fluid is transmitted undiminished in all Instructions. This theory allows for the technology of huge drive with relatively little enter Electrical power, building hydraulics ideal for hefty-obligation duties. Hydraulic units typically consist of a pump (which generates circulation), valves (which Command path, strain, and circulation), actuators (which convert hydraulic Strength into mechanical motion), and fluid reservoirs.

Using hydraulic fluids—normally oil—enables devices to generate, Command, and direct Power with Extraordinary precision. Contrary to mechanical devices, where by friction may result in don and tear, hydraulic units use fluid to build smooth movement, which minimizes upkeep necessities and boosts toughness. This adaptability helps make hydraulics critical in industries wherever large masses, large precision, or sophisticated actions are essential.

Important Apps of Hydraulic Technology Throughout Industries

Hydraulics Participate in a crucial position in many sectors, like building, producing, and transportation. In the construction Industry, As an example, hydraulics tend to be the spine of equipment for instance excavators, bulldozers, cranes, and backhoes. These devices depend on hydraulic Power to raise, thrust, and transfer enormous loads effortlessly. The construction of skyscrapers, highways, and bridges wouldn't be attainable without the pressure and suppleness of hydraulic equipment.

In production, hydraulic presses and forming equipment shape and mold supplies with precision. The chance to apply constant, managed tension allows companies to operate with metals, plastics, as well as other resources proficiently. Whether It is stamping automobile components or shaping delicate Digital elements, hydraulics make certain that producing procedures are the two highly effective and precise.

In the transportation sector, hydraulics are integral for the Procedure of plane, ships, and automobiles. Aircraft use hydraulic devices to manage landing equipment, brakes, and flight control surfaces, whilst ships use hydraulics for steering, winching, and cargo dealing with. In vehicles, Power steering and braking programs rely upon hydraulic mechanisms to provide motorists with Manage and safety. The use of hydraulics in these purposes permits sleek and responsible Procedure, particularly in devices where by mechanical Power alone could be inadequate.

Benefits of Hydraulic Methods More than Mechanical and Electrical Techniques

One among the greatest strengths of hydraulic techniques is their ability to deliver enormous quantities of power within a compact Area. While mechanical systems have to have huge components to generate very similar pressure, hydraulic methods can achieve superior Power density through the usage of fluid tension. This enables for smaller sized, more economical patterns which might be effective at executing significant-responsibility tasks with no occupying too much space.

In addition, hydraulic devices offer remarkable control and precision. The chance to wonderful-tune force and circulation allows operators to execute jobs with a large degree of accuracy. This is particularly essential in industries like aerospace, in which even the smallest deviation in movement or power may have critical penalties. In distinction to electrical systems, which can are afflicted by interference or Power reduction, hydraulic devices offer dependable, reliable Power even in difficult environments.

One more edge is the sturdiness and robustness of hydraulic devices. The usage of fluid instead of strong mechanical linkages lowers friction and don, which prolongs the lifespan with the equipment. This helps make hydraulic techniques a lot more ideal for harsh environments, which include mining operations or offshore oil rigs, where by equipment is subjected to Severe pressures, temperatures, and corrosive components.

Technological Advancements and the way forward for Hydraulic Techniques

The evolution of hydraulic Technology proceeds, driven by progress in elements, style, and automation. Modern hydraulic devices have gotten much more successful, decreasing Strength use and enhancing performance. One example is, variable displacement pumps and load-sensing Technology enable for more precise Charge of fluid flow, which minimizes Power squander and boosts General system effectiveness.

Also, The mixing of electronic technologies and automation is reworking hydraulic methods into smart techniques. Sensors, controllers, and genuine-time checking instruments are getting used to enhance hydraulic efficiency, predict routine maintenance desires, and increase security. These improvements are paving the way in which for hydraulic systems to Enjoy a crucial function in the event of autonomous machines and robotic programs, specifically in industries like manufacturing, agriculture, and logistics.

As environmental fears increase, the Industry is also concentrating on making additional sustainable hydraulic techniques. New fluid formulations which might be biodegradable and environmentally friendly are being made, and hydraulic programs are becoming far more energy-effective to lessen their environmental impact. These improvements are significant as industries seek out to stability the need for Power and effectiveness with the demand for sustainability.
